The Catalyst Business Energy Market Brief – April 2010

The Catalyst UK energy market brief, is a brief analysis of short and long term key energy market drivers, effecting gas and electricity prices, market conditions and future energy price outlook. The monthly report helps you make an informed decision about your commercial energy procurement strategy.
